United StatesChange Country, Oracle Worldwide Web Sites Communities I am a... I want to...
Bug ID: JDK-4622481 GridBagLayout specification lacks tags
JDK-4622481 : GridBagLayout specification lacks tags

Details
Type:
Bug
Submit Date:
2002-01-11
Status:
Closed
Updated Date:
2004-03-20
Project Name:
JDK
Resolved Date:
2003-09-13
Component:
docs
OS:
solaris_2.5,generic
Sub-Component:
guides
CPU:
sparc,generic
Priority:
P3
Resolution:
Fixed
Affected Versions:
1.4.0,5.0
Fixed Versions:
5.0 (tiger)

Related Reports

Sub Tasks

Description

Name: idR10193			Date: 01/11/2002


Undescribed arguments of GridBagLayout methods prevent test development.

The specification for the following methods is incomplete and
lacks tags specified below:

Category 3: Tag Error 

preferredLayoutSize(Container) 
  Missing tag    - @param parent 
  Extraneous tag - @param target 
  Missing @return tag. 

minimumLayoutSize(Container) 
  Missing tag    - @param parent 
  Extraneous tag - @param target 
  Missing @return tag. 

maximumLayoutSize(Container) 
  Missing @return tag. 

getLayoutInfo(Container, int) 
  Missing tag    - @param parent 
  Missing tag    - @param sizeflag
  Missing @return tag. 

GetLayoutInfo(Container, int) 
  Missing tag    - @param parent 
  Missing tag    - @param sizeflag
  Missing @return tag. 

adjustForGravity(GridBagConstraints, Rectangle) 
  Missing tag    - @param constraints
  Missing tag    - @param r

AdjustForGravity(GridBagConstraints, Rectangle) 
  Missing tag    - @param constraints
  Missing tag    - @param r

getMinSize(Container, GridBagLayoutInfo) 
  Missing tag    - @param parent 
  Missing tag    - @param info
  Missing @return tag. 

GetMinSize(Container, GridBagLayoutInfo) 
  Missing tag    - @param parent 
  Missing tag    - @param info
  Missing @return tag. 

arrangeGrid(Container) 
  Missing tag    - @param parent 

ArrangeGrid(Container) 
  Missing tag    - @param parent 

======================================================================

                                    

Comments
EVALUATION

Added missing tags.  Reviewed by Richard Ray.  Fixed for hopper.
###@###.### 2002-04-09

I had added the tags to the lower-case methods.  I didn't realize we need to document obsolete methods as well.  I got approval from Patrick Curran, and Alan Sommerer to refer to the lower-case methods for details on the parameters and return values.  This improves documentation readability and updateability.  Also, I fixed the broken links.  Fixed for tiger.
###@###.### 2003-07-29
                                     
2003-07-29
PUBLIC COMMENTS

.
                                     
2004-06-10
CONVERTED DATA

BugTraq+ Release Management Values

COMMIT TO FIX:
generic

FIXED IN:
tiger

INTEGRATED IN:
tiger
tiger-b15

VERIFIED IN:
tiger


                                     
2004-06-14



Hardware and Software, Engineered to Work Together